Ferries run from Lipsi to Leros (All Ports) 6 days a week, all year-round. The first ferry of the day departs from Lipsi at 10:20, and the last at 23:30. From June to September, there are around 12 crossings per week. In quieter periods, the route is served by 7 crossings per week. The fastest ferry from Lipsi to Lakki, Leros of Leros, takes 20min. The average trip duration for all ferries is 36min arriving at Agia Marina, Leros - Lakki, Leros ports. Ticket prices start at €5.50 and go up to €26.00. Taking luggage with you on the ferry to Leros

When traveling from Lipsi to Leros (All Ports), luggage is typically included at no extra charge.

Luggage Allowance: Ferry companies usually allow one suitcase per person (max 50 kg), but some may have different policies. Details for each ferry:

  • SAONISOS, BLUE STAR 1, BLUE STAR PATMOS: Up to 50kg per passenger.
  • DODEKANISOS EXPRESS, PRIDE: Up to 40kg per passenger.

Please label your luggage clearly and place it in the designated storage areas when you board. Extra charges might apply for large or extra bags, depending on the ferry company.

Traveling with your pet on the ferry

Pets can travel on ferries from Lipsi to Leros, though each company may have its own rules. The basics:

  • Pets over 10 kg go in onboard kennels, while smaller ones (under 10 kg) can travel in a pet carrier.
  • Service dogs are not subject to kennel rules.
  • Bring all needed documents and pet supplies.
  • On Greek domestic routes, pets typically travel free.

In Leros, there are several ferry terminals, including Agia Marina, Leros - Lakki, and Leros - Panteli. Agia Marina is close to the island's main town, while Lakki, located on the western side, is also near key amenities and services.
